What do the speakers mainly discuss?
W: Look, I’m sorry, but the books for Chem. 100 aren’t in yet.
M: Why not? School started last week.
W: I really don’t know. Maybe the professor ordered them late, or the pub lisher ran out of them and they are on back order.
M: This is awful. I’m worried about this course anyway. I didn’t do that well in chemistry in high school.
W: I know what you mean. Did you check the used book section?
M: Yes. No luck there.
W: Okay. Look, why don’t you go over to the library? I’ll bet that the profes sor put at least one copy on reserve.
M: Do you think so? That would be great. At least I could make copies of the pages that I need until the books come in. Oh, wait. If there’s only one copy, everyone will be trying to do that.
W: True. Well, we do have a bulletin board. You could put a notice up that you are looking for a book for Chemistry 100, and maybe someone who has it will want to sell it directly t~ you. Do you have a phone in the dorm?
M: Yeah. I’ll just put my name and phone number on the notice. That’s a great idea! Where’s the bulletin board?
W: By the T-shirts and clothing near the front door. Oh, and be sure to put down the exact title of the book, too, because they don’t always use the same one.
M: Thanks. You’ve been a big help.
选项
A、He is starting the course late.
B、The subject is difficult for him.
C、The professor is very reserved.
D、The book is difficult to read.
答案
B
